Charlotte Smith, Irving Park Consulting, (Kalamazoo) At Large

 

Charlotte J. Smith is the President and CEO of Irving Park Consulting, LLC, which provides operations and organizational management consulting services aimed at improving efficiency and performance of nonprofit organizations. Charlotte previously worked as the Deputy Director of the Local Initiative Support Corporation (LISC) for both the Flint and Kalamazoo offices.  She was responsible for day-to-day operations in Flint and assisted with administrative operations in the Kalamazoo office.  Prior to joining LISC in 2017, Charlotte was the Deputy Director for Community Services at the Kalamazoo County Health and Community Services Department.  In that role, she was responsible for overseeing the community services divisions of the county health department, including: Health Equity; Maternal and Child Health; Veterans Services; Area Agency on Aging; and the Community Action Agency. Earlier in her career, she spent 18 years at the State of Michigan’s Office of Children’s Ombudsman (OCO), including an executive appointment as Acting Director. The OCO is a watchdog agency that investigates social workers’ handling of child abuse, foster care, adoption, and juvenile justice cases and recommends legislative and policy changes aimed at improving the child welfare system.  She has a law degree from the University of Akron (Ohio) College of Law and a bachelor’s degree in Public Policy and Government from Eastern Connecticut State University. Charlotte has served on the CEDAM Board of Directors for several years and is currently the board President.
